## PR: Archive cold storage buckets (Glacierline)

Adds a sweeper that moves objects untouched past the retention threshold into Glacierline archive tiers, then verifies checksums before deleting originals. Security review focus: deletion only happens after verified archive write, and the sweeper runs under the scoped archiver role, not admin. All thresholds are centralized in one module; the tuning constants are shown below.

constants for tageg-kagag:
QUOTAS = {
    "kelax": 495,
    "istath": 366,
    "tammir": 108,
    "novdor": 730,
    "casax": 816,
    "quenael": 874,
    "pelius": 403,
}

// Heads up, reviewer: this constant caps concurrent virtual shoppers
// for the Cartwheel checkout load tests. We learned the hard way on
// Project Brindle that pushing past 4k sessions melts the staging
// payment stub before it tells us anything useful about real limits.
// Keep it here unless Perf signs off — the nightly soak on the
// Tanagra cluster assumes this value when computing p99 budgets.
// If you bump it, rerun the full checkout soak and attach results.
// The baseline run these numbers came from is tagged below.

pipeline stamp: htk31_f769b577b3028a4e9958e5bb8d1259a

Fan-out backpressure for the Quillet notifier: when the queue depth crosses the soft limit, the dispatcher sheds low-priority pushes and batches the rest at 500ms intervals. Reviewer should confirm the shed counter is exported and that retries respect the jitter window. Once merged, the release artifact gets re-signed by the pipeline, which expects the deploy key shown below.

deploy key for bawep-yawif: bky6_GQhaSt

Finance Review Summary — Licensing Dispute, Veltrane Systems

For the incoming director: the dispute with Korvath Media concerns royalty calculations on the Lumiary toolkit licence. Our counsel believes Korvath's interpretation of the usage clause overstates our liability by roughly forty percent. We have reserved against the worst case but expect settlement nearer the midpoint. Arbitration in Delford begins next quarter, and external counsel fees are tracked separately. Settlement strategy is tied to plans noted confidentially below.

internal memo for yahag-tahog: The pricing group signed off on a budget of $152.8 million for Project Soriel.